Background
The casting mold is a mold used for forming a casting in a casting forming process, and is characterized in that other easily-formed materials are used for forming the structural shape of the part in advance, then the mold is placed in a sand mold, so that a cavity with the same structural size as the part is formed in the sand mold, a fluid liquid is poured into the cavity, the liquid is cooled and solidified to form the part with the same structural shape as the mold.

In fig. 1 and 2, specifically, the lower die box 20 includes three die box frames 1 stacked on each other, the hand-held plate 2 is disposed on the outer side wall of the middle die box frame 1, the hand-held plate 2 is fixedly connected with the die box frame 1, and the hand-held plate 2 is disposed to facilitate a worker to take and place the die box frame 1.
In fig. 3, the locking mechanism 3 includes a pulling rope 31, a locking swivel nut 32 and a locking screw 33, the number of the pulling rope 31 is two, one end of each of the two pulling ropes 31 is fixedly connected to the two handrails 2 located on the upper side and the lower side, the other end of each of the pulling ropes 31 is connected to the locking swivel nut 32 and the locking screw 33, the locking swivel nut 32 is fixed to the locking screw 33 in a threaded manner, a female thread 321 is formed on the inner side wall of the locking swivel nut 32, a male thread 331 is formed on the outer side wall of the locking screw 33, the locking screw 33 is fixed to the locking swivel nut 32 in a threaded manner through the female thread 321 and the male thread 331, and the locking mechanism 3 composed of the pulling rope 31, the locking swivel nut 32 and the locking screw 33 can be screwed in when in use. In the locking screw 32, the two pulling ropes 31 can be pulled tightly by gradually rotating the locking screw 32, so that the upper mold box 10 and the lower mold box 20 can be pulled tightly and fixed, and the stability of the internal sand mold 30 is ensured.
In fig. 2, a core air hole 401 is formed in the core 40 through the cavity 50 and the sand mold 30, a gate 501 is formed in the sand mold 30, the gate 501 penetrates into the cavity 50, and when the casting mold is used, the casting liquid is poured into the cavity 50 from the gate 501 and is formed in the cavity 50, and the core air hole 401 is used for dispersing air.

1. The automobile drum brake casting mold is characterized by comprising an upper mold box (10) and a lower mold box (20) which are clamped with each other, a sand mold (30) is filled in the upper mold box (10) and the lower mold box (20), a core (40) is arranged in the sand mold (30), a cavity (50) is formed between the core (40) and the sand mold (30), the upper mold box (10) and the lower mold box (20) are composed of a plurality of mold box frames (1) which are clamped with each other, a hand support plate (2) is fixedly arranged on the outer side wall of one of the mold box frames (1), and a locking mechanism (3) used for limiting the upper mold box (10) and the lower mold box (20) is arranged between the two hand support plates (2) on the upper mold box (10) and the lower mold box (20).
2. The automobile drum brake casting mold according to claim 1, wherein the upper mold box (10) comprises three mold box frames (1) stacked on each other, a clamping groove (11) is formed in the top of each mold box frame (1), a clamping shaft (12) in clamping fit with the clamping groove (11) is fixedly arranged at the bottom of each mold box frame (1), the clamping shaft (12) is inserted and fixed in the clamping groove (11), and two adjacent mold box frames (1) are fixed through the clamping shaft (12) and the clamping groove (11) in a clamping manner.
3. The automotive drum brake casting mold according to claim 2, characterized in that the lower mold box (20) comprises three mold box frames (1) stacked on top of each other, the hand-rest plate (2) is arranged on the outer side wall of the mold box frame (1) located in the middle, and the hand-rest plate (2) is fixedly connected with the mold box frame (1).
4. The automobile drum brake casting mold according to claim 1, wherein the locking mechanism (3) comprises two pulling ropes (31), two locking thread sleeves (32) and two locking screws (33), one ends of the two pulling ropes (31) are fixedly connected with the two handrails (2) on the upper side and the lower side respectively, the other ends of the pulling ropes (31) are connected with the locking thread sleeves (32) and the locking screws (33) respectively, and the locking thread sleeves (32) are fixed with the locking screws (33) in a threaded manner.
5. The automobile drum brake casting mold according to claim 4, wherein a female thread (321) is formed on an inner side wall of the locking screw sleeve (32), a male thread (331) is formed on an outer side wall of the locking screw rod (33), and the locking screw rod (33) and the locking screw sleeve (32) are fixed through the female thread (321) and the male thread (331) in a threaded manner.
6. An automotive drum brake casting mould according to claim 1, characterized in that the core (40) has core air holes (401) formed through the cavity (50) and the sand mould (30).
7. The automobile drum brake casting mold according to claim 1, wherein a gate (501) is formed in the sand mold (30), and the gate (501) penetrates into the cavity (50).
